After Nana Patekar, Aamir Khan Adopts Two Drought-Hit Villages

Aamir Khan has adopted two villages in Maharashtra, Tal and Koregaon, that are reeling under drought.

After Nana Patekar and Akshay Kumar’s large-hearted gestures, Aamir Khan is doing his bit. He has adopted two villages in Maharashtra that are reeling under drought. He recently visited the worst-affected regions of the state and decided to adopt Tal and Koregaon, two villages that have been facing maximum hardship. He is committed to supporting and uplifting them.

This is not the first time Aamir has extended aid to villages in adverse circumstances. He adopted villages in Kutch, Gujarat, following the states worst-ever earthquake in 2001.

Addressing a programme organised by the NGO Pani Foundation, he said:

The water issue in Maharashtra is worsening every passing day. To tackle this problem permanently, we have to give preference to the success of Jal Yukta Shivar and similar projects.
Aamir Khan
